python
文章平均质量分 73
ActionLi
这个作者很懒,什么都没留下…
展开
-
python代码(4) ---兔子毒药问题
今天听到一个智力问题,很有意思。 大致是这样的:1000瓶无色无味的液体,其中一瓶为毒药,其它皆为清水,毒药只取一滴与清水混合为一瓶也可以毒死兔子。现在有10只兔子,当兔子喝下毒药两个小时后死去,请设计一种方案,能够在24小时内找到这瓶毒药。 。。。。。。。。。。。。。。 2分钟后 前面的问题你一定想清楚了,那么略改动一下:1000瓶无色无味的液体,其中一瓶为毒药,其它皆原创 2007-07-20 20:30:00 · 2259 阅读 · 0 评论 -
python 中参数传递 * 和 ** 的问题,以 tuple和dict方式传递参数
在python中,有时会看到这样的函数定义: def p1(*arg1,**arg2): pass也有看到这样的函数调用: i=5 function(*i)这些都是什么意思呢?1.传入的参数生成 tuple 和 dict def p1(*a1,**a2): print a1,/n,a2 p原创 2007-08-18 10:34:00 · 10143 阅读 · 0 评论 -
python小应用---修改MP3
转自:http://agilejava.blogbus.com/logs/1068361.html上周买了一个MP3播放器,挺好的。昨天下了一些Queen的MP3,拷贝到了MP3里面,在路上一听,才发现格式 错误。回到家里到电脑上放,可以的啊。仔细的检查了一下文件,发现这次下的MP3里都有一张Queen专缉的图片,这就导致了我的MP3无法播放这些 MP3了。今天到公司,正好上网找了一下MP转载 2007-08-25 10:02:00 · 1912 阅读 · 0 评论 -
python代码(1)---冒泡排序
def bubble(list): flag=1 tail=len(list)-1 while(flag): flag=0 for i in range(tail): if list[i]>list[i+1]: t=list[i] list[i]=list[i+1]原创 2007-06-07 22:41:00 · 1120 阅读 · 0 评论 -
python代码(2)---google中国编程挑战赛入围赛真题HardDuplicateRemover(1000分)
问题分析(问题描述见后面):首先建立一个dup表,来记录duplicate item下一次出现的下标,如果没有下一相同的item,则记为0.循环dup表: 当前位置i 如果没有duplicate值,直接写到输出tlist中. 有duplicate值: 寻找 head , tail下标值. head=i(当前循环到的位原创 2007-06-07 23:09:00 · 1830 阅读 · 1 评论 -
词频统计---python与C++的执行效率分析
Question: 一个全英文文本,统计每个单词出现的次数,按次数从大到小排列,输出到文本文件中。Data:MIT的Python教程---Python Programming : An Introduction to Computer Science,大约800K。C++:#include #include #include #include #include #include #in原创 2007-06-09 11:06:00 · 6182 阅读 · 1 评论